Atenţie! Aceasta este o versiune veche a paginii, scrisă la 2018-03-15 22:28:07.
Revizia anterioară   Revizia următoare  

 

Fişierul intrare/ieşire:lacapatullumii.in, lacapatullumii.outSursăConcursul National de Informatica "Adolescent Grigore Moisil" 18
AutorAdăugată deAGMinformaticaAGMInformatica AGMinformatica
Timp execuţie pe test0.005 secLimită de memorie20480 kbytes
Scorul tăuN/ADificultateN/A

Vezi solutiile trimise | Statistici

C. La capatul lumii

Se considera n monede, fiecare avand probabilitatea Pi sa pice cap. Stiind ca s-a extras cu random una din cele n monede, a fost aruncata de k ori si s-a notat ce a picat de fiecare data, se cere sa se afle expected value de numarul de capuri care vor pica daca s-ar arunca aceeasi moneda de inca m ori.

Date de intrare

Fişierul de intrare lacapatullumii.in contine pe prima linie t, reprezentand numarul de teste. Pentru fiecare test in parte, prima linie contine un numar natural n. A doua linie contine n probabilitati, fiecare avand exact 3 zecimale dupa virgula. Urmatoarele 2 linii contin k si un sir de lungime k care contine numai 0 si 1, 0 inseamnand ca a picat pajura si 1 insemnand ca a picat cap. Ultima linie din fisier contine un singur numar, m.

Date de ieşire

În fişierul de ieşire lacapatullumii.out trebuiesc afisate raspunsurile pentru fiecare test pe linii separate.

Restricţii

  • ... ≤ ... ≤ ...
    n <= 10.000
    m <= 100.000.000
    k <= 1.000

Exemplu

lacapatullumii.inlacapatullumii.out
1
3
0.666 0.500 0.334
2
01
100
50

Explicaţie

...

Trebuie sa te autentifici pentru a trimite solutii. Click aici

Cum se trimit solutii?